An update on this. 

For one, it seems to be related to DFHack. Framerate goes back to normal when I uninstall it.

Also, I failed to mention it in the OP, but it's purely an issue with graphical fps. The internal game fps is unaffected, and the effect is independent of what's going on simulation-wise; I get the same fps drop on a fresh 1x1 embark. Also, it's only in tiles mode; ASCII is fine.
But the weirdest thing (and, I would guess, most relavant for the sake of identifying the problem) is that it only occurs at the standard zoom level (i.e. at the tiles' native resolution). Zooming in or out fixes it (wtf).

DF General Discussion / Massive framerate drop updating to 50.07
« on: February 11, 2023, 04:27:02 pm »
Today I updated the game from 50.05 which I had held off on doing until new a dfhack version was released, but, upon loading my old save, I noticed my framerate had dropped from 45-49 (it's capped at 50) to below 20. This already happens the moment the save is loaded, with the exact same game state in both versions.

I don't expect good performance from my sub-shitty PC, but such a drop in framerate looks like it's caused by something in the new update rather my hardware generally being too crappy for DF. 

Anyone else having similar problems and/or any insights on what might be the cause?

edit: I should add that only the graphical framerate is affected, the simulation framerate remains the same between the two versions
